About Prague

Prague has a long history that goes back a thousand years. It was once the capital of the Kingdom of Bohemia, a mighty mediaeval realm that significantly impacted European history. Prague is often called the "Mother of Cities" in central Europe for its enduring charm. The city is rich in culture and has been home to famous artists, musicians, and writers. Franz Kafka, one of the well-known literary figures of the 20th century, found inspiration in Prague's labyrinthine streets.

This UNESCO World Heritage nestled on the banks of the Vltava River is a living canvas that tells a story spanning from Bohemian antiquity to neo-classical elegance to the vibrant modern era.   • Vltava River: The Vltava River, the Czech Republic's longest river, stands as an essential attraction in Prague, offering visitors a compelling experience. Embark on a captivating river cruise that unfolds the city's allure in two distinctive dimensions: a delightful daytime voyage and a mesmerising evening tour. The river acts as a shimmering mirror, reflecting pages of a history book and encapsulating centuries of history and culture.
  • Prague Castle: Prague Castle is the largest castle complex in the world, as per the Guinness Book of World Records. The castle used to be the seat of the kings of Bohemia, and at present, it has become the official residence of the president of the Czech Republic. Set a whole day for this tour, as you will spend the entire day exploring the gardens, museums and tombs of Prague Castle. Only a few people know that Kafka has spent time writing here. The place is filled with wonder, excitement, spooky stories, and charm, thus making it the perfect gateway to fulfil your desires for exploration.
  • Strahov Monastery: Strahov Monastery is one of the oldest monastic houses in the city. The historic and cultural gem was founded in 1143. The monastery is renowned for its stunning library, featuring an extensive collection of rare manuscripts, books, and artistic treasures. The Theological Hall and Philosophical Hall are notable parts of the library, showcasing remarkable Baroque architecture. There is also a captivating basilica and a picturesque courtyard, making it a popular tourist destination for those interested in history, culture, and architectural beauty. It offers a glimpse into centuries of Czech heritage.
  • Prague National Theatre: The Prague National Theatre, a cultural icon in the Czech Republic, was inaugurated in 1881. Designed in Neo-Renaissance style, it is a testament to Czech national identity. The theatre has three artistic ensembles: drama, opera, and ballet, performing classical and contemporary works. It's famous for its exceptional acoustics and opulent interiors. The golden roof and stunning frescoes of the auditorium make it a visual delight.
  • Museum Kamp: Museum Kampa is a prominent contemporary art museum. Situated on the picturesque Kampa Island on the Vltava River, it showcases a diverse collection of modern and contemporary Central European art, including works by renowned Czech and international artists. The museum is housed in a historic mill building, creating a unique atmosphere for art appreciation. The place offers visitors an opportunity to explore innovative and thought-provoking artworks while enjoying the scenic beauty of the island and its surroundings.
  • Museum of Senses: The Museum of Senses in Prague is an immersive and interactive attraction designed to engage visitors' sensory perceptions. It offers a unique and mind-bending experience, stimulating sight, touch, sound, and more through exhibits and optical illusions. This museum encourages visitors to explore the limits of their senses and provides an entertaining, educational, and interactive journey. It's a family-friendly destination that appeals to all ages, offering a playful and thought-provoking adventure.

Prague Airport (PRG)

Prague Airport, officially known as Václav Havel Airport Prague (PRG), is the largest international airport in the Czech Republic, catering to all the flights to Prague. It is located about 10 km west of the city centre and is the main gateway for international travellers to Prague and the surrounding region. The airport has two passenger terminals: Terminal 1 primarily handles flights to non-Schengen countries, while Terminal 2 serves Schengen and domestic flights. The airport offers various services, including shops, restaurants, car rental services, and lounges for travellers. Prague Airport is well-connected to the city centre by different transportation options, including buses, airport express, and taxis. It's a convenient 30-minute ride to the city.

Important things to know when travelling to Prague

  • To beat the crowds and make the most of your day, visit iconic sites like Prague Castle and Charles Bridge early in the morning.
  • The currency in Prague is the Czech Koruna (CZK). While credit cards are widely accepted, carrying some cash for smaller purchases is helpful.
  • While many people in Prague speak English, learning a few basic Czech phrases like "hello" and "thank you" can be appreciated by locals.
  • Don't miss out on traditional Czech dishes like goulash and trdelník (a sweet pastry). Explore local restaurants and street food vendors for an authentic culinary experience.
  • Prague's historic centre is best explored on foot. Wander through its charming streets and alleys, and take in the stunning architecture and ambience.
  • Be mindful of local customs and etiquette, especially when visiting religious sites. Dress modestly and maintain a respectful demeanour.

About Ahmedabad

Before you take your flights to Prague, do not forget to explore a treasure trove of experiences in the cultural extravaganza of Ahmedabad. It is the largest city in Gujarat and a dynamic metropolis blending a rich historical legacy with modern progress. It is renowned for its role in India's struggle for independence and as the home of Mahatma Gandhi's Sabarmati Ashram. The city is an economic and industrial hub with a booming textile industry. It has a deep-rooted connection with textiles and is famous for its intricate handwoven fabrics. Ahmedabad also boasts remarkable architecture, such as the Akshardham Temple and the Sidi Saiyyed Mosque. Its educational institutions and bustling urban environment make it a captivating and evolving city. The diverse cultural heritage of the town is quite prominent in its language, architecture, clothing and lifestyle. Ahmedabad's vibrant culture includes traditional Garba and folk dances, colourful festivals like Uttarayan (kite festival), and mouthwatering Gujarati cuisine. The city gets brighter during Navratri with intricate garba dancing showcasing its love for music and dance. The town also celebrates Diwali, Holi and Eid with great enthusiasm, thus reflecting the multicultural spirit of the city. Besides, the numerous street food options and mouthwatering dishes like khandvi, dhokla and fafda are popular.

Ahmedabad Airport (AMD)

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el International Airport (AMD) is regarded as the 8th busiest airport in the country. Located 9 km north of central Ahmedabad in Hansol, the airport is well-maintained, modern, and well-designed to fulfil the growing needs of travellers. It has a single integrated terminal handling both domestic and international traffic, including the flights to Prague. You can experience seamless transportation facilities since they are well connected to the city and surrounding areas with taxi, car rentals, and bus services. The airport has amenities and facilities like dining options, shopping, and lounge services. It also facilitates free Wi-Fi, medical facilities, currency exchange and booking, and child care.
